Subject: [pve-devel] [PATCH v2 manager 4/6] vzdump: avoid 'requires'
 constraint when parsing defaults

to avoid warnings like
parse error in '/etc/vzdump.conf' - 'storage': missing property -
'notes-template' requires this property
when there is no default for the required property configured.

In new(), the defaults are mixed in with the regular CLI/API
parameters, so re-check if the required property is set. If it's not,
the defaults do not apply to the current run, and can be dropped.
